Assessing Tree Health and Safety Concerns

The decision for urban tree removal often stems from assessments of tree health and safety concerns. Arborists evaluate factors such as disease, decay, structural instability, and proximity to structures or power lines. When a tree poses a risk to property or public safety, removal becomes a responsible and necessary course of action.

Preserving Urban Ecosystems: A Delicate Balance

While urban tree removal is sometimes imperative, preserving urban ecosystems remains a priority. Expert arborists approach tree removal with a focus on maintaining ecological balance. They consider alternatives such as pruning, disease management, or structural support when possible, ensuring that removal is only pursued when other options prove insufficient.

Navigating Legal and Regulatory Aspects

Urban tree removal is subject to legal and regulatory frameworks aimed at preserving green spaces and maintaining environmental balance. Expert arborists navigate these complexities, ensuring compliance with local regulations. This may involve obtaining permits, adhering to environmental impact assessments, and following protocols to minimize the ecological footprint.

Implementing Sustainable Wood Recycling Practices

In cases where urban tree removal results in significant wood waste, sustainable recycling practices come into play. Expert services may implement recycling initiatives, turning removed trees into wood chips, mulch, or lumber for community projects. This sustainable approach minimizes waste and contributes to the circular economy.
